A prominent drinks dispense solutions provider in Leeds is seeking an Installations Planner. You will be the key contact for technicians and customers, ensuring efficient planning and organization of installation visits.
The ideal candidate will possess strong communication skills and experience in administration, with a flexible approach and attention to detail.
Join our team to help keep Britain pouring while enjoying competitive pay and extensive benefits including a hybrid working model and generous holiday allowance.
